    She is an enemy of our Constitutional rights

    I am not even exaggerating here. This woman hates the second amendment. Just take a look at her own campaign site! Tulsi strongly supports a number of gun control measures, including:

    – A federal ban on military-style assault weapons and high capacity magazines

    – Requiring comprehensive pre-purchase background checks

    – Closing the gun-show loophole

    – Making sure that ‘terrorists’ are not allowed to buy guns

    – Tulsi’s support of gun control has led to her rating of 100% by the Brady Campaign to Prevent Gun Violence, along with an “F” rating from the NRA and a 0% rating from the Hawaii Rifle Association.

    – Tulsi participated in the House sit-in in 2016 when Republicans refused to allow any members to vote on any gun control legislation.

    – In working towards enacting real gun control measures, Tulsi is focusing on bipartisan measures that have a chance of actually becoming passed into law, rather than using the issue as a political football.

    Would be cool if Tulsi meant what she says, instead she hangs around at AIPAC, CUFI, the CFR and AEI and votes for massive military budgets while serving up her empty anti-war rhetoric.In 2016 Gabbard received $465,000 from PAC money. Most of the money (55%) came from business PACS, with one of the largest sectors being the defense industry. Her 2016 campaign raised $65,000 from the defense sector. Donations of $10,000 came from the Boeing Corporation PAC and from Lockheed Martin’s PAC. Her own leadership PAC, Time to Unite Lead and Serve with Integrity, received funds from Raytheon.

    So tell me again how Gabbard is supposed to be an anti-war candidate.
